Key Components of Shein’s Approach
One of the standout features of Shein’s marketing is its focus on data-driven decisions. By analyzing customer preferences and trends, Shein ensures that its products meet the demands of its target audience. This allows the brand to optimize its inventory and maximize sales.
- Utilizing social media influencers for broader reach
- Engaging customers through user-generated content
- Offering limited-time promotions to create urgency
Shein’s use of social media platforms has revolutionized how brands interact with customers. Regular posts, viral challenges, and collaborations with influencers help foster a community around the brand. This not only increases visibility but also enhances customer loyalty.
Leveraging Influencer Partnerships
Partnerships with influencers allow Shein to reach new demographics. These influencers create authentic content that resonates with their followers, effectively promoting Shein’s products without overt advertising. By showcasing products in everyday settings, influencers make it easy for their audience to envision themselves wearing Shein’s styles.

The impact of social media on Shein’s success
The impact of social media on Shein’s success is significant and multifaceted. By utilizing various platforms, Shein has built a massive online presence that enhances its brand visibility.
Building Community through Engagement
Social media platforms allow Shein to engage directly with its customers. By actively responding to comments and sharing user-generated content, Shein creates a sense of community. This interaction not only builds loyalty but also encourages customers to become brand ambassadors.
- Utilizing platforms like Instagram and TikTok for direct engagement
- Sharing customer reviews and photos to build trust
- Creating branded hashtags to foster community participation
Moreover, Shein holds regular contests and giveaways on social media, enticing followers to participate and share their experiences. This strategy not only increases follower counts but also generates excitement around the brand.
Leveraging Influencer Partnerships
Influencers have played a crucial role in Shein’s marketing strategy. By collaborating with popular figures in the fashion industry, Shein extends its reach to diverse audiences. These partnerships create buzz and authenticity as influencers share their personal experiences with Shein products.
